Galatians 3:12-14
New Catholic Bible
12 However, the Law is not based on faith. On the contrary, whoever does these things shall live by them.
13 Christ redeemed us from the curse of the Law by becoming a curse himself for us, as it is written, “Cursed is everyone who is hung upon a tree.” 14 This is so that the blessing bestowed upon Abraham might be extended to the Gentiles through Jesus Christ so that we might receive the promise of the Spirit through faith.

Galatians 3:12-14
New International Version
12 The law is not based on faith; on the contrary, it says, “The person who does these things will live by them.”[a](A) 13 Christ redeemed us from the curse of the law(B) by becoming a curse for us, for it is written: “Cursed is everyone who is hung on a pole.”[b](C) 14 He redeemed us in order that the blessing given to Abraham might come to the Gentiles through Christ Jesus,(D) so that by faith we might receive the promise of the Spirit.(E)
